DESCRIPTION:History Fort Lauderdale presents “Three by the River\,” an Artists-in-Residence annual exhibition\, from June 4 to June 30. Featured will be acrylics by Constance Ivana\, mixed media works by Stephanie McMillan\, and portraits by Florencia Clement de Grandprey. \nConstance Ivana is a Fort Lauderdale–based mural artist and visual creative passionate about creating bold\, vibrant artwork that sparks reflection\, conversation\, and joy. Her art is inspired by social justice\, Black stories\, women’s voices\, and nature. \nStephanie McMillan is a third-generation Fort Lauderdale resident and artist. Her distinctive style combines affectionate humor with the bright colors of the sunny tropics. A graduate of the\nTisch School of the Arts at NYU\, with a focus in animation\, she began drawing illustrations and editorial cartoons\, for which she won several Florida Press Club awards. This led to 25 years as a widely published freelance cartoonist and illustrator producing award-winning editorial cartoons\, syndicated comic strips\, comic journalism\, and graphic novels. In recent years she has returned to painting\, drawing\, and mixed media assemblage. She is the author/illustrator of several books including As the World Burns and The Beginning of the American Fall: A Comics Journalist Inside the Occupy Wall Street Movement (Seven Stories Press). Her original sketches\, illustrations\, comics\, and papers are archived at the Billy Ireland Cartoon Library and Museum at Ohio State University. \nBorn and raised in southern Spain\, Florencia Clement de Grandprey is a self-taught mixed media figurative artist whose mission is to empower and inspire through meaningful and uplifting artwork. Her artistic journey began in 2014 when she left her full-time job in interior design to follow her true passion: painting. Clement de Grandprey has developed a style without rules\, granting her the freedom to express herself fully. She blends her love for the classic masters with contemporary design\, resulting in unique mixed media paintings. Her award-winning work celebrates strong\, confident\, soul-aligned men and women. She aims to highlight our unique\, perfectly imperfect nature\, bringing out our strengths and beauty as a reminder of who we truly are. DESCRIPTION:As part of Hued Songs’ Juneteenth Experience 2026\, “Where We Stay” is a free visual art exhibition curated by Tayina Deravile and featuring nine Broward-based visual artists. Presented at the Daisy Arts Center\, the exhibition explores the commonalities of home within Black communities through works centered on family\, memory\, adornment\, personal lived experience and cultural legacy. The exhibition celebrates the history of the Sistrunk neighborhood and honors the legacy of Dr. James and Daisy Sistrunk\, whose home became a gathering place for jazz musicians\, dignitaries\, artists and community leaders. Featured artists include Allison Bolah\, Adrienne Chadwick\, Amaya Estrada\, Clarence Josey II\, Emmanuel George\, Shawna Moulton\, Cornelius Tulloch\, Carrington Ware and Chris Friday. DESCRIPTION:In this South Florida premiere\, THE COLOR PURPLE is a powerful musical adaptation of Alice Walker’s Pulitzer Prize-winning novel and the acclaimed 1985 Steven Spielberg film. This epic tale follows Celie\, a young woman who endures unimaginable hardship\, yet embarks on a profound personal journey over the course of 40 years.
